#tooltip-container { position: absolute; z-index: 999; top: 0; left: 0; } .tooltip-wrap { position: absolute; display: none; // Position and display are set by React background: @black; border-radius: @border-radius-base; color: @text-color-inverse; font-weight: @font-weight-medium; box-shadow: 0 0 8px rgba(0,0,0,0.4); text-align: center; text-transform: capitalize; .tooltip-content { padding: 0.5em; } .tooltip-pointer { position: absolute; width: 0; height: 0; top: -13px; left: 50%; margin-left: -6px; border: 7px solid transparent; border-bottom-color: @black; border-bottom-width: 6px; } }